No gold ammo or anything ala WoT, nothing that you can not get ingame with ingame credits. A statement to avoid both "pay2win" as well as "grind2win".
(A highend ship like the Constellation has been said to take ~ 60 hours of gameplay to acquire in game without ever spending any real cash at all. Hardly outrageous for a highend goal.)
+ it's an actual spacesim where combat is all about piloting skill and aim.
Frankly... I believe that anyone buying those ships expecting to "pwn" people with "pay2win" ships will be rather disappointed.
Looks more like an early "leg up" so you can right away pick the ship with the role/specialication that you want to fly, instead of having to start in the newbie ship ... but somehow I doubt it will really matter what you pledged for after the first couple of weeks.
